We’re hiring a Trading Research Analyst within Jump's Centralized Trading team. This role combines live trading support and market research: you’ll help monitor trades and execution processes while producing market and performance analysis that informs trading decisions. This is a generalist role suited to candidates with a strong attention to detail, good market knowledge,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.

What You’ll Do:

• Monitor live orders, executions, positions, P&L and risk limits during market hours; promptly flagging and escalating issues to the appropriate team

• Triage order rejects, breaks, and system incidents; coordinate rapid resolution with traders, operations, engineering and brokers

• Produce regular market summaries and ad hoc research; track news, macro/corporate events, sentiment, and catalysts, turning insights into actionable ideas

• Provide traders with market context, trade ideas, and impact assessments for events such as earnings and corporate actions

• Communicate clearly across teams; document processes and production issues to ensure transparency and continuity

• Prepare daily reports and commentary on themes relevant to trading strategies; maintain depth of knowledge on the Indian market structure, economy, and political landscape

• Build and maintain datasets, dashboards, and automated reports to support trading and research needs; perform routine data validation and reconciliation

• Run ad-hoc queries and basic analyses (Excel, SQL, or scripting) to answer data requests, validate hypotheses, and inform trade decisions

•  Other duties as assigned or needed

Skills You’ll Need:

• At least 3 years of relevant experience in trading operations, execution support, market research or data analysis

•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ent) in Finance, Economics, STEM, or related field

• National Institute of Securities Markets (NISM) certification: NISM-Series XVI or MCX MCCP Certification

• Strong attention to detail, ability to prioritize under pressure, and effective written/verbal communication

• Comfortable working in shifts or during market hours

• Familiarity with multiple asset classes (equities, futures, options) and basic derivatives concepts

• Basic scripting or data skills (Python, SQL) for analysis and reporting

• Reliable and predictable availability
